NPR’s interview with Phoenix:

“…the band has found wider recognition, even being called “Rock’s Great French Hope” by Rolling Stone magazine after its latest effort, this year’s superb Wolfgang Amadeus Phoenix. The album has appeared on many critics’ best of the year lists, thanks in part to the singles “Lisztomania” and “1901,” which was featured in a recent Cadillac car commercial.”

Every time that commercial comes on the television, I usually stop what I’m doing and listen/dance/sing. Thank you Cadillac for appealing to good music listeners.
Also, I think NPR is obsessed with the band. They are being mentioned almost every time I listen.
